How much do contract embedded tester jobs pay per year?

As of May 31, 2026, the average yearly pay for contract embedded tester in the United States is $102,146.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$85,500.00 and $124,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Contract Embedded Tester vs Contract Software Tester?

AspectContract Embedded TesterContract Software Tester
CertificationsISTQB, ISTQB-CT, or similarISTQB, CSTE, or similar
Work EnvironmentEmbedded systems, hardware integration, real-time environmentsApplication software, web, mobile apps
Industry UsageAutomotive, aerospace, consumer electronicsFinance, healthcare, e-commerce
Work FocusHardware-software interaction, firmware testingFunctionality, usability, performance testing

Contract Embedded Testers focus on testing embedded systems, firmware, and hardware integration, often requiring knowledge of electronics and real-time environments. Contract Software Testers primarily test application software across various platforms. While both roles involve testing skills and certifications like ISTQB, their work environments and focus areas differ significantly, catering to different industry needs.

Embedded Software / Firmware Test Engineer
Job Summary:
This position will require the candidate to develop hardware, software and firmware to test sequencing products at Illumina, Inc. The candidate will work with automated tests on a regular basis and will also utilize SQA skills to write and execute manual tests in accordance with the company's established development and test methodology. The successful candidate will display a strong sense of ownership, motivation, and attention to detail. Additionally, the candidate must have the proven ability to manage interdisciplinary relationships.
Job Responsibilities:
Develop software, firmware, and hardware to test embedded systems.
Write and execute manual and automated tests. Carefully analyze and document test results.
Operate a variety of laboratory instrumentation and simulators to perform integration testing, system testing, and functionality testing.
Assist in troubleshooting system problems.
Lead test requirement analysis and review meetings. Report on test activities.
Work with scientists, technicians, engineers, marketing, and project management to deliver commercial and internal systems.
Assist developers and domain experts in designing, performing, and improving verification tests.
Write formal firmware and FPGA test requirements specifications and documentation, including test plans, how-to guides, cookbooks, reference material, technical overviews, etc.
Required Skills & Experience:
Bachelor's degree in electrical or computer engineering.
Experience working hands on with circuits, boards, microcontrollers/embedded systems, FPGA, etc.
Programming with C/C++, Scripting (Python, Perl, Tcl, etc), MATLAB.
Experience working on multiple projects simultaneously.
Possess proven troubleshooting skills.
Have proven ability to self-manage, as well as manage interdisciplinary relationships.
Be curious, detail oriented, and analytical, with a proven ability to learn quickly.
Be customer-focused, team-oriented, and motivated, taking ownership of assigned tasks.
Preferred Skills & Experience:
Experience with test infrastructure such as LabView / National Instruments.
Experience with Source Control (Subversion, git), Visual Studio.
Understanding of Optics and Fluidics.
Experience with PCB design and layout.
Programming with VHDL/Verilog
Ability to participate in product development tasks related to electrical and firmware engineering.
Understanding of Molecular Biology, Bioinformatics, or related field of biology.
Understanding of Mechanical Engineering.
